Sadly, being a noobish I can’t vote for someone. I don’t understand how much they can help or change the system.

They can raise their voice when CCP asks for feedback and point out possible problems that comes with this or that idea. Or bring some topics to CCPs attention. They cannot enforce anything, but guide discussions.

You are best advised to look at the candidates and their campaign topics to look in which regions of space they are active and what their opinions are on some of the games aspects. And then vote for those you think have the right stance towards your game style.

So if you are a highsec-missionrunner or -miner, vote for someone who stands for making that part fo the game more interesting or has many years or expertise with it. Just as example.
